The PSU im using currently is a JLM Powerstation in an external box because i have a big external PSU in the making that will power my whole SSL 5K mixer, il get some pics up of that too,
I actually used common earthing Krone blocks for the io like these:

http://www.canford.co.uk/Products/46-104_KRONE-237DB-Module

As they are very easy and tidy to wire and it worked out rather well, they are basically punch down bus bars used in broadcast and telecoms (if you are not familiar with them already).

And here's my newly built SSL Summing Station Lunchbox.
It uses a 555F summingcard (the same summingcircuit as the 552), into a 521 stereoline amp, with a 522 EQ in the dyn/eq bus, and a 520 busscompressor in the insert.

It has 2x SubD inputs for the summing, and a stereo input via XLR. With the frontpanelswitch labeled "Summing In", the XLRs will be summed with the SubD's, when it's out, the summingcard is bypassed, and the stereo inputs will be sent straight into the 521.

I have modified the 521 a little bit. The insertswitchinglogic is disconnected from the audioswitching. The audioswitching of the insert is set to "on" permanently, so that the 520 compressor is routed in the insert all the time. The actual insert switch and the latchingcircuit is rewired to a pair of relays mounted on the rearpanel, that switches an external stereo insert in and out (xlr's on the rear, pre-compression).

I also have added a "Keith's balancing circuit" board for balancing the monitor outputs.

And here's how I've made the resistornetworks on the sub-d's. I hope my explanation (in crappy english) and pictures say enough, whahaha :

-Solder the resistors into the audio busses, and also solder wire into the grnd busses.
-Bend the groundwires to the side.
-make 4 rows : 1 row of negative odd, 1 row of positive odd, 1 row of positive even, and a row of negative even. Solder bridges to connect these :
IMAG0291-1.jpg


-Solder a ring around the subD to connect all the grounds. (not a closed ring, more like a U).
IMAG0293-2.jpg


Isolate the 1st and 3rd row with heatshrink tube. The other 2 rows are then automatically isolated as well. (though, make sure the groundwires don't come near the audioconnections).
IMAG0294-1.jpg


Attach the wiring that goes into the summing amp.
IMAG0296-1.jpg


I don't have a picture made of the last stage !!!  But, in the last picture you can see a second sub-d connector that's finished. I use isolationtape to cover the top. And after that, I used a larger piece of heatshrink to keep everything in place, and to make sure the sticky tape residue won't come off, or out, after a few years.
